About The Position

The Crystal Growth Technician is responsible for executing controlled crystal growth processes to produce high-purity silicon and/or germanium crystals that meet defined quality, performance, and customer requirements. This role ensures precise control of process parameters, accurate documentation, and material traceability in compliance with ISO quality management system requirements and applicable ITAR regulations.

Responsibilities

  • Perform assigned duties in accordance with approved procedures, work instructions, travelers, and safety requirements
  • Set up, operate, and monitor crystal growth furnaces and associated processing equipment
  • Prepare, verify, and load raw materials and charge compositions in accordance with approved specifications
  • Monitor and control critical growth parameters including temperature profiles, pull rates, rotation speeds, and atmospheric conditions
  • Adjust process parameters within defined limits to maintain crystal structure, purity, and quality
  • Perform in-process and post-growth inspections including visual inspection, dimensional measurement, and defect identification
  • Conduct material qualification, acceptance testing, and disposition of grown crystals in accordance with established procedures
  • Maintain accurate records of growth conditions, process data, lot traceability, and inspection results in compliance with document control requirements
  • Generate technical and material reports to support internal review and customer requirements
  • Identify process deviations and initiate corrective actions in accordance with established procedures
  • Troubleshoot equipment and process issues; assist with preventive maintenance, calibration, and system verification activities
  • Ensure proper handling, identification, storage, and protection of high-purity and brittle materials
